But here goes..... My own personal beef with Shay was how he treated one particular player. He 'released' him at essentially the last minute to make room for another, graduate transfer. This guy had uprooted his life, moved across the country, and took a redshirt the previous year, waiting on his "big chance" the next one (which was last season) - only to be cut loose for a *perceived* better option. I know it's a rough 'business', but come on - that's cold. And that's not speculation; that's the way it went down. I suspected Forbes had been doing that, too, for the previous 2-3 years (and almost certainly was), but the way Shay did it was clumsy and almost embarrassingly cruel. [I guess I'm old school, and prefer the old model of a coach and school being loyal to a player (and vice versa) for 4 years. Obviously, that's not the current world, but I don't like it.]

Besides that.............Shay wasn't a great 'face' of the program, especially after Forbes. As you all well know, Forbes plays well in the media; Shay just didn't. There's a reason for that, imo, but I'm not sure that needs to be mentioned here.

As to how/why his tenure ended....................as sirdeacalot notes, it was essentially due to the backasswards political climate here. The SI story and other publicity basically caught most of the truth, but without some nuances. The President initially stood up for him (and the team) after the "kneeling incident" in Chattanooga, but then was 'forced' to back away when push came to shove, by state political myopia. Sad, but true. On the other hand...........it may have been the best for both Shay and ETSU in the long run. Time *may* tell. What never came out were the details of the legal settlement that Shay and his agent 'won' from ETSU. We had to pay his salary for the rest of his contract terms, basically (approximately). So he's making serious coin now, but that's ok; he should.

All that said.............Shay is the exact perfect complement to Forbes on the sideline. His forte, like Forbes, is maximizing for each player their strengths. And I know that's a cliche, but it's really true in his case.
